Output 952395226a8a8f99b4f6ff0a08160e991121282dce6635a0bbf9ef22469e2f22:1

value
26292221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854ca19c52d8876ff285bab58cc1ae0954c47abd OP_EQUAL
address
3DqqbVXdb4hzoPYHLg7sP2PVSCcmeFxAqs
transaction
952395226a8a8f99b4f6ff0a08160e991121282dce6635a0bbf9ef22469e2f22
spent
true